The Contractor Agreement Driver with a Felony in Bexar is a legally binding document between an independent contractor and a common carrier company. This form is designed for contractors who may have felony convictions and serves to outline the terms of transportation services provided by the contractor to the carrier, ensuring compliance with state laws and regulations. Key features include insurance requirements, invoicing procedures, liability clauses, and the responsibilities regarding freight handling. The agreement specifies that the contractor must maintain appropriate insurance coverage and provide necessary documentation to the carrier promptly. Additionally, it includes clauses about the contractor's obligation to inform the carrier of any delays and their role as an independent contractor.
